WebFeb 10, 2014 · Numbers smaller than ten should be spelled out. Two birds were sitting on a branch. (NOT ‘2 birds were sitting on a branch.’) Two-word numbers should be expressed in figures. Examples are: 24, 32, 56 etc. I got only 35 marks in English. (More natural than I got only thirty-five marks in English.) One-word numbers can be spelled out. WebSep 10, 2012 · Numerical diversity notwithstanding, there are some rules applicable to general writing that most copy editors in the United States agree should be followed. Here are seven of the most common rules. 1. Spell out whole numbers smaller than 10. The Associated Press, New York Times, and APA style guides agree on this point.
